The 3.1-mile loop that Aventura residents walk, run, and bike every day is about to get its first complete overhaul.
The City of Aventura announced that the Don Soffer Exercise Trail will be fully repaved and leveled beginning Monday, July 13. The project will fix cracks and root damage that have accumulated since the trail was originally built, and it will add new water fountains equipped with bottle fillers and dog bowls along the entire circuit.
The work is expected to take approximately six weeks, putting the estimated completion around late August.
What trail users need to know
The trail will be closed in sections during construction, and according to the city, each closed section will not reopen until the entire project is finished. The city has not specified which sections close first or whether any portion of the loop will remain accessible throughout the six-week window.
That means if your usual stretch goes down early in the project, plan on finding an alternate route for the full duration.
The trail
The 10-foot-wide, ADA-accessible path circles the Turnberry Isle Resort Golf Course at 19999 W. Country Club Drive. It is open 24 hours a day, year-round, and free to the public. Residents use it for walking, running, jogging, inline skating, and biking. Many locals simply call it "The Aventura Circle."
The path already features ground lighting, benches, chilled water fountains, trash receptacles, crosswalks, and pet waste bag dispensers. After the repaving, the city said, the entire surface will be leveled and the new fountain stations will include modern bottle fillers and low dog bowls.
The trail is named after Don Soffer, the real estate developer widely credited as the godfather of Aventura, who developed the Turnberry golf course and Aventura Mall. Soffer died in July 2025 at age 92.
The city asked residents for patience during the closure.
